Output 9e84850e6fe9887944d7ed6fb03bd842f025258e8ae9b78c97735456d136fb91:3

value
139109492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b9aa575e676ad14fba6ea3f245a8611b2d870f OP_EQUAL
address
MFzJ7Zxk1WT33yGbFPwGsDGApJbzbJPm9P
transaction
9e84850e6fe9887944d7ed6fb03bd842f025258e8ae9b78c97735456d136fb91
spent
true